      Now, I will be the first to admit that I do NOT have a green thumb, and I'm sure I'm not alone.  Real plants in a home are always the best choice - unless the real plants are half dead or all dead.  There is nothing worse that a brown or mostly brown plant setting in a room.  A room should feel uplifting, not depressing which is the feeling you get with a dead plant in the room.
     This does not mean that I am advocating the use of "fake" plants in your home.  However, I see many homes filled with fake plants.  If you insist on using dried/plastic/silk plants in your home, please limit them.  Do not load the tops of your cabinets with ivy or any other plant.  Perhaps an accent here or there would be acceptable, but please use them only as an accent and use them sparingly. 
     Less is more!
